The West Bengal Homeopathic System Of Medicine Act, 1963State Act of West Bengal · Act 33 of 1963

(1) No person, association or institution other than the Council shall confer, grant or issue, or hold himself or itself out as entitled to confer, grant or issue, any degree, diploma, licence, certificate or any other document stating or implying that the holder, grantee or recipient thereof is qualified to practise the Homoeopathic system of medicine.

(2) Any contravention of the provisions of sub-section

(1) shall be punishable with imprisonment which may extend to one year or with fine which may extend to one ithousand rupees, or with both; and if an association or institution is guilty of such contravention, every member thereof who knowingly or wilfully authayises or permits the contravention, shall be punishable with imprisonment which may extend to one year or with fine which may extend to one thousand rupees, or with both.
